Advisory Committee is 12531. Comment We have heard that peginterferon will be approved as a single drug soon, maybe this week. The Advisory Committee will consider the combination with ribavirin. Our understanding is that Roche plans to sell its peginterferon alone as well. FDA advisory committee meetings are often the best place to learn in-depth information about a new drug before it is approved. They are not called for every new drug application, only for those that present new, difficult, or particularly important issues. Usually a transcript and a summary appear later on the FDA Web site. The FDA is not required to follow the recommendations of its advisory committees, but it almost always does. |
